Ingredients List

  • 1 cup gluten-free flour – This is the base of our snack, providing the right texture without the gluten.
  • 1/2 cup cornmeal – Adds a lovely corn flavor and a bit of crunch to the mix.
  • 1 tsp baking powder – This helps the snack rise, making it light and fluffy.
  • 1/2 tsp salt – A pinch of salt enhances all the wonderful flavors!
  • 1 cup shredded cheese – I love using a sharp cheddar for that ooey-gooey goodness, but you can switch it up!
  • 1/2 cup milk – This keeps everything moist and adds richness.
  • 2 large eggs – They act as a binder and help everything stick together.
  • 1/4 cup melted butter – For that extra buttery flavor and richness that everyone loves.

How to Prepare Instructions

  1. First things first, let’s preheat that oven to 375°F (190°C). You want it nice and toasty for baking!
  2. In a large mixing bowl, combine the gluten-free flour, cornmeal, baking powder, and salt. Give it a good stir to mix everything together evenly.
  3. Now, it’s time to add the fun stuff! Toss in the shredded cheese, milk, eggs, and melted butter. I love using my trusty spatula to mix it all together until it’s just combined. Don’t overdo it— we want a smooth batter, but a few lumps are totally fine!
  4. Next, pour that cheesy goodness into a greased baking dish. Spread it out evenly so it bakes nicely. You can use a spatula or just tilt the dish a bit to help it settle.
  5. Pop it in the oven and bake for about 25–30 minutes. You’re looking for a golden-brown top that smells heavenly!
  6. Once it’s baked to perfection, let it cool for about 10 minutes before you dive in. This resting time really helps set everything up for easy cutting!

Tips for Success

Now that you’re ready to make these delicious snacks, here are some of my top tips to ensure they turn out perfectly every time!

  • Experiment with cheese: While I love sharp cheddar, you can try pepper jack for a spicy kick or mozzarella for a milder flavor. Mix and match to find your favorite combination!
  • Spice it up: Don’t hesitate to add your favorite spices! A pinch of cayenne or smoked paprika can add a delightful depth of flavor. You could also toss in some chopped jalapeños or herbs for an extra zing!
  • Check for doneness: Keep an eye on your baking time. Ovens can vary, so start checking around the 25-minute mark. The top should be golden brown, and a toothpick inserted in the center should come out clean.
  • Let it rest: I know it’s tempting to dive right in, but letting the snack cool for the recommended 10 minutes helps it firm up, making it easier to cut into perfect pieces.
  • Storage tip: If you have leftovers (which is rare!), store them in an airtight container. They’ll stay fresh for a few days, and you can easily reheat them in the oven for that just-baked taste!

Variations

If you’re feeling adventurous, there are so many fun ways to mix this recipe up! Here are some of my favorite variations that can transform these gluten-free snacks into something uniquely yours:

  • Different cheeses: Swap out the cheddar for your favorite type of cheese! Gouda adds a nice smoky flavor, while feta can bring a tangy twist. For something creamy, try ricotta or cream cheese mixed in!
  • Veggie-packed: Load these up with some finely chopped veggies! Spinach, bell peppers, or even grated zucchini can add extra nutrition and flavor. Just make sure to squeeze out excess moisture from veggies like zucchini to keep your batter from getting too wet.
  • Herbs and spices: Get creative with fresh herbs! Basil, cilantro, or chives can add a burst of freshness. You can even sprinkle in some Italian seasoning or taco seasoning for a different flavor profile.
  • Alternative flours: If you want to experiment, you can try using almond flour or coconut flour. Just keep in mind that you may need to adjust the liquid ratios, as they behave a bit differently than regular gluten-free flour.
  • Sweet twist: Feeling like a sweeter option? Try adding some honey or maple syrup along with a sprinkle of cinnamon for a delightful snack. You could even fold in some chocolate chips for a dessert-like treat!

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Alright, let’s talk about how to keep those delicious gluten-free snacks fresh and ready for your next munching session! If you happen to have any leftovers (which is a challenge in my house!), the best way to store them is in an airtight container. This keeps them from drying out and helps maintain that lovely cheesy texture. You can pop them in the fridge, where they’ll stay good for about 3-4 days.

When you’re ready to enjoy them again, I recommend reheating in the oven to bring back that just-baked taste.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and place the snacks on a baking sheet. Heat them for about 10-15 minutes, or until they’re warmed through and the cheese is all melty again. If you’re in a hurry, you can use the microwave, but be careful! Microwaving can sometimes make them a bit chewy. Just heat in short bursts of 30 seconds, checking often to avoid overcooking.

FAQ Section

Can I use regular flour instead of gluten-free flour?
While I love this recipe as a gluten-free option, you can definitely use regular all-purpose flour if gluten isn’t a concern for you. Just keep in mind that it might change the texture slightly, but it should still taste great!

How can I adjust the serving size?
If you need more or fewer servings, you can easily double or halve the recipe. Just remember to adjust your baking dish size accordingly. A larger dish will require a bit more baking time, so keep an eye on it!

Can I make these snacks 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can prepare the batter in advance and store it in the fridge for a few hours before baking. Just let it come to room temperature before you bake it. You can even bake them a day ahead and reheat them for game day!

What are some good gluten-free alternatives for cheese?
If you’re looking for dairy-free options, there are some fantastic gluten-free cheese alternatives available now. Look for brands that melt well, like cashew-based cheeses, which can add a nice creaminess to your snacks!

How can I make these snacks spicier?
If you want to kick up the heat, try adding diced jalapeños or a bit of hot sauce directly into the batter. You could also top them with spicy salsa or serve them with a side of sriracha for dipping. Yum!

What’s the best way to store leftovers?
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3-4 days. They’re still delicious the next day! Just remember to reheat them in the oven for the best texture.

Can I freeze these snacks?
Yes, you can freeze them! Just make sure they’re completely cooled before wrapping them tightly in plastic wrap or placing them in an airtight container. They should keep well in the freezer for up to 2 months. Thaw them in the fridge overnight before reheating.
